**02:14** — Nightly reindex on the Marrowgate search cluster stalled at 61%. Indexer pods were OOM-killed after the synonyms file doubled in size from the evening content push. On-call restarted with the bumped heap profile and the run completed by 03:40. For correlation in the log archive, the failed run's trace token is recorded below.

session token of tajog-fahaf = htk21_4ae55819f45410afcb307

Good cleanup overall. The main win here is caching compiled templates in the Fernwick renderer instead of re-parsing on every request — that alone cut render time roughly in half on the staging bench. Two things to watch: the cache is per-worker, so memory scales with process count, and partials invalidate the whole entry, not just themselves. For new folks, the bench harness lives in the perf folder. The cache sizing constants we settled on are below.

tuning table, kajog-bawip:
TIERS = {
    "kelius": 256,
    "lammir": 543,
}

## Limits & Quotas

Welcome to the Murmur Gallery audio-guide team! The app streams narration clips, so we cap concurrent streams per visitor and throttle downloads on museum wifi to keep things smooth during school-trip rushes. Most quotas live in one config module. The values currently in production are these.

tuning table, bawip-bahap:
BUDGETS = {
    "gorir": 473,
    "kelius": 138,
    "silion": 345,
    "aldmir": 429,
    "tamdor": 108,
    "oliir": 987,
    "belius": 539,
}

**Mgmt Meeting Minutes — Retiring the Brightline Range**

Quick recap for sales leads at Fenholt Supplies: we agreed to retire the Brightline fixture range by year-end. Remaining stock moves to clearance pricing next month, and accounts on standing orders get migrated to the Lumetta range. Trade-in incentives were approved in principle. The confidential note on next steps sits just below.

board note of bajof-bajeg: The pricing group signed off on a budget of $13.4 million for Project Sildor. The renewal with Lamixek Holdings closes at $48.9 million a year, 49 percent above the last contract.